INTRODUCTION:

Coffee is a beverage prepared from roasted coffee beans. Darkly colored, bitter,
and slightly acidic, coffee has a stimulating effect on humans, primarily due to its
caffeine content. The Seeds of the Coffee plant's fruits are separated to produce
unroasted green coffee beans. The beans are roasted and then ground into fine
particles that are typically steeped in hot water before being filtered out, producing
a cup of coffee. It is usually served hot, although chilled or iced coffee is common.
